一、项目配置https
在后端(2)-springboot配置项及编译打包中已经介绍了关于https打包的内容
二、打包
springboot的打包常见为jar、war两种格式,区别是:
1、jar可以独立部署,里面已经集成了tomcat
2、war则不能独立部署,需要通过tomcat去启动。
三、上传阿里云
上传到阿里云服务器目录,通过ssh(比较麻烦),我使用的是客户端finalShell,很方便。
四、启动程序
启动springboot jar的方式:
1、后台运行关闭窗口不退出程序
nohup java -jar ***.jar &
2、单次启动,关闭窗口后程序退出
java -jar ***.jar
停止程序
停止已经启动的jar的方式:
1、后台运行停止
通过ps -ef | grep java查找java相关的进程,
找到进程pid,通过kill -9 <PID>强制停止
2、单次启动停止
ctrl+C可以直接停止